Notes:

1) For single system installations set Serial ID (S100), and Machine Motion (J303) as shown in Unit 1,

jumpers J106 and J107 must be closed.

2) On multi-system installations refer to the illustration.

Jumpers J106 and J107 are left open on all systems except for the very last system where

they are in the closed position.

Termination resistors (120-ohm) or termination jumpers must be installed/set at the CNC for

each of the RS-422 RX and TX signal pairs.

3) If a Hypertherm Automation Controller is being used, and there are intermittent communication

failures (PS Link Failure), try removing the jumpers on J106 and J107 on the control board, and the

termination jumper (J6 or J8) on the serial isolation board in the controler. Only remove

the termination jumper on the serial isolation board that is connected to the HPR

power supply. See sheet 17 for more details.
